The Ministry of Labour and Social Development said that preparations have been finalized to deposit the quarterly meat subsidy compensation for October, November and December.
The amount of BD6,557,957.500 will be deposited into the beneficiaries’ bank accounts in the beginning of October in favour of 153,568 Bahraini families.

As many as 363 Egyptians returned home from Libya via Salloum crossing over the past 24 hours, said Marsa Matrouh Security chief Mokhtar el Senbary.
Out of all the returnees, 303 Egyptians returned legally and 60 illegally, he noted in statements on Tuesday.
Travel procedures for 1,012 people, including 294 Egyptians and 718 Libyans, have been finalized, Senbary added.
